Review: Best composition book I've ever read - I picked this book up at the suggestion of the great contemporary realist painter, Will St. John; I think he learned from it. This is the abridged and updated 1969 Dover edition of _Pictorial Composition and the Critical Judgment of Pictures_, which Poore originally published in 1903, and which is out of print; there are paper copy facsimiles of the 1903 version to be bought and unfortunately I found out the hard way they contain no illustrations so they're useless. Get this one. I've read a lot of books on composition but still find so much to learn from the Poore that I keep having to put it down and absorb what he's just taught me. His instruction is succinct and clear. I wish I'd stumbled on this decades ago. You'll find more modern books on composition but the ones I have are just a waste of your time compared to this one. Poore analyzes in a deep way why pieces work and why they don't and how to fix them. The modern books I have just list formulae, do circles or steelyards, or golden sections, etc., and the writers aren't really capable of analyzing the subtleties of why something works when it's oh-so-close and why it doesn't, or why a certain composition might be the wrong one for the subject matter. Poore really knows his material cold and is articulate enough to explain reasons in very few words. Composition is the most important aspect aspect of painting; you can have great anatomy, brushwork, and color and if your composition is faulty the piece falls apart, whereas with a great composition, the rest just falls into place, and for the most part, mistakes are forgiven. So this is a great book on composition. The other great book I have read is also ancient and out of print, Cyril Pearce's _Composition_, referred to me by Stephen Bauman, and worth finding. The Poore is a little better but they talk about completely different things so to me, they compliment each other. If you're serious about improving your painting, search out them both.
Review: Really Deserves 6 Stars - This is one of the most thorough books in the teaching and analysis of composition I've ever had the fortune to read. All my other art books mention the neccessity of sound composition and eye movement but none give the detailed breakdown of how that's accomplished or why it fails. This book does. You aren't just told - it's broken down for you explicitly with dozens of examples from famous paintings. All kinds of compositions are examined. Here is a list of the chapter titles and some (would be tiresome to include it all) of what they teach 1. Balance - rules, scale of attraction, vertical/horizontal balance, natural balance, apparant/formal balance, balance by opposition of line, balance by opposition of spots, transition of line...etc, etc, etc. 2. Entrance and Exit - getting into the picture, getting out of the picture 3. Circular Observation - circular composition, reconstruction for circular observation 4. Angular Composition - the triangle, the vertical line in angular composition, angular composition based on the horizontal, line of beauty, structural line 5. Composition with One or More Units - 2 units, 3 units, groups, the figure in landscape 6. Light and Shade - pricipality, gradation Color Plates..... If you really want to learn composition and get it down cold - get this book. It's a priceless gem.
